36 Pho Phuong

avatar
petitedragon
Thirty-six Lines Ancient Street With a history of thousands of years, it was once the economic prosperity center of Hanoi. Each street focuses on a certain business, hence the name "Thirty-six Lines Street". Close to the Hoan Kiem Lake, it is the heart of Hanoi. There are people coming and going on the street, cars are constantly flowing, and motorcycles are shuttling between them. This army of motorcycles is too chaotic, and it is too difficult to cross the road😥 The air in the street is full of gasoline (incomplete combustion) exhaust smell... I am not used to it. You can stop and have a cup of coffee☕️ to feel this rare lively atmosphere.

St. Joseph Cathedral

avatar
n****x
St. Joseph's Cathedral is a must-visit landmark for anyone exploring Hanoi. This stunning Gothic cathedral, built during the French colonial era, stands as a testament to the city's rich history and architectural heritage.Here's why you should add it to your itinerary:Architectural Marvel: The cathedral's imposing façade, twin towers, and intricate stained glass windows are simply breathtaking. Its neo-Gothic design, reminiscent of Notre Dame Cathedral in Paris, creates a serene and awe-inspiring atmosphere.Historical Significance: As one of the oldest churches in Hanoi, St. Joseph's Cathedral has witnessed significant historical events. It's a place where you can connect with the past and appreciate the city's cultural diversity.Peaceful Surroundings: The cathedral is nestled in a tranquil square, surrounded by lush greenery. Take a moment to sit on one of the benches, soak in the peaceful ambiance, and watch the world go by.Photo Opportunities: The cathedral's majestic architecture provides endless photo opportunities. Capture the stunning façade, the intricate details of the stained glass windows, or simply the serene atmosphere of the square.Tips for Visitors: * Dress Modestly: While visitors of all faiths are welcome, it's respectful to dress modestly when entering the cathedral. * Respectful Behavior: Maintain silence and avoid disruptive behavior inside the cathedral, especially during prayer times. * Best Time to Visit: Early morning or late afternoon are ideal times to visit when the crowds are smaller and the lighting is more favorable for photography.Whether you're a history buff, an architecture enthusiast, or simply seeking a peaceful retreat, St. Joseph's Cathedral is a must-visit destination in Hanoi.

Ba Dinh Square

avatar
朱朱Hello
Ba Tingguang, Hanoi, Vietnam (Vietnamese: Quảng trờng Ba nh) is located in the center of Hanoi, capital of the Socialist Republic of Vietnam, with an area of 14.5 hectare 1. It is an important venue for gatherings and festivals in Vietnam. It is equivalent to Tiananmen Square in our country, but it is smaller than Tiananmen Square, only one-eighth of Tiananmen Square. The square is also distributed around the Great Hall of the People, President Hu Memorial Hall, and the former residence of Ho Chi Minh. There is also the presidential palace of Vietnam, which is the political center of Vietnam.
